Hi,
since we enabled to run the unit test suite on the Debian build servers there
was a unit test failure on alpha:

Running suite(s): GstObject
85%: Checks: 7, Failures: 1, Errors: 0
gst/gstobject.c:75:F:general:test_fail_abstract_new:0: Early exit with return
value 0
FAIL: gst/gstobject

This needs of course further investigation. Any thoughts on how this could
happen? Maybe a bug in check?




Apart from that there was only the known bug on ppc/s390 that is probably
compiler related and probably not worth noting as there is another bug about
this I was told:

Running suite(s): data protocol
80%: Checks: 5, Failures: 1, Errors: 0
libs/gdp.c:150:F:general:tf:0: GST_BUFFER_IN_CAPS flag should have been copied
!
FAIL: libs/gdp
